The first thing that you need to do to begin a career in this dynamic field is to choose a medical office management degree program in Nevada. Keep in mind that there are no state-specific requirements as to which type of degree you should attain, but there are industry standards that are in-line with most employers’ hiring practices.

The majority of employers in Nevada will be looking to hire a medical office manager with the minimum of a bachelor degree in medical office management. The industry, in general, considers the master degree to be standard, but many physicians’ offices and hospitals in Nevada are completely willing to accept the bachelor degree for entry-level medical office management employment. There are associate degree programs as well; however, larger clinics and hospitals tend to prefer a bachelor degree or higher.

While the curriculum varies between medical office management degree programs in Nevada, the courses listed below are likely to be mandatory with any degree program in this field:

  • Medical Law and Bioethics
  • Software Applications for Health Care Professionals
  • Diseases of the Human Body
  • Medical Office Management
  • Medical Insurance and Billing

Once you have completed your degree program, you will begin a hands-on externship training program. This is a graduation requirement, and the purpose of this training program is to give medical office management students in Nevada the opportunity to work in a medical office and assist with its daily managerial functions.

Through both online and campus-based programs, future medical office managers in Las Vegas, Henderson, North Las Vegas, and Reno, Nevada will find themselves more than prepared for careers with some of the state’s largest medical facilities, including Spring Valley Hospital, Sunrise Hospital, Desert Springs Hospital, and Northern Nevada Medical Center.
